The patient lake donkeys...

Nyon - Vaud (Switzerland)

The secret is simple…Getting up early in the morning, immediately after sunrise, maybe even a little before it.

All is silence and quite freshness.
The very early morning sun is less cruel.

The pedal boats are still resting, they float peacefully like gentle little donkeys on a liquid meadow.

They have nobody on their back now and they are happy.
